
GEO测序数据的分析涉及数据下载、数据预处理、数据标准化、差异表达分析、功能富集分析、可视化等步骤。数据下载是最基础的一步,可以通过GEO数据库直接下载所需的测序数据。差异表达分析是其中最关键的一步,它能够帮助研究者找到在不同条件下基因表达的差异。这一过程通常包括数据标准化、模型构建和统计检验,以确保结果的可靠性和准确性。下面将详细介绍GEO测序数据分析的具体步骤。
一、数据下载
GEO(Gene Expression Omnibus)是一个公共的功能基因组数据存储库,可以通过它下载大量的基因表达数据。访问GEO数据库,可以通过输入关键词、样本类型、物种等筛选出所需的测序数据。下载数据时,可以选择不同的格式,如TXT、CSV、SOFT等。下载后,解压缩文件,并准备进行数据预处理。
二、数据预处理
数据预处理是数据分析的基础步骤,主要包括数据清洗、去除低质量数据、缺失值处理等。具体步骤如下:
- 数据清洗:去除不必要的注释信息和低质量的样本。
- 去除低表达基因:剔除那些在大多数样本中表达量极低的基因,以减少噪声。
- 缺失值处理:可以选择删除含有缺失值的样本或使用插值法填补缺失值。
三、数据标准化
数据标准化是为了消除技术性变异,使得不同样本之间的表达数据具有可比性。常用的方法包括:
- Quantile normalization:使得所有样本的表达值分布相同。
- Log2 transformation:将表达值取对数,以减少数据的变异性和非对称性。
四、差异表达分析
差异表达分析是GEO测序数据分析的核心步骤,目的是找出在不同实验条件下显著差异表达的基因。常用的方法和工具包括:
- DESeq2:适用于RNA-Seq数据的差异表达分析,使用负二项分布模型,能够处理低表达基因和测序深度差异。
- edgeR:另一个常用的差异表达分析工具,基于负二项分布,适用于较小样本量的数据分析。
- limma:适用于微阵列数据的差异表达分析,使用线性模型,适应性强。
在这些工具中,研究者需要设定适当的阈值,如p值和Fold Change,以筛选出显著差异表达的基因。
五、功能富集分析
功能富集分析旨在通过对差异表达基因进行功能注释,揭示其在生物过程、细胞组分和分子功能中的潜在作用。常用的方法和工具包括:
- GO (Gene Ontology) 分析:通过GO数据库对基因进行功能注释,分为生物过程(BP)、细胞组分(CC)和分子功能(MF)三大类。
- KEGG (Kyoto Encyclopedia of Genes and Genomes) 分析:对基因进行代谢通路分析,揭示其在代谢途径中的作用。
- GSEA (Gene Set Enrichment Analysis):通过基因集富集分析,找出在不同条件下显著富集的基因集。
六、数据可视化
数据可视化是展示分析结果的重要手段,可以通过各种图表直观地展示差异表达基因及其功能富集分析结果。常用的可视化工具和方法包括:
- 火山图(Volcano Plot):展示基因表达的Fold Change和p值,帮助识别显著差异表达的基因。
- 热图(Heatmap):展示基因表达的聚类结果,直观显示不同样本之间的基因表达模式。
- 条形图(Bar Plot)和气泡图(Bubble Plot):展示功能富集分析结果,显示显著富集的GO或KEGG通路。
七、验证和进一步分析
验证分析结果的可靠性和准确性是非常重要的,可以通过以下几种方法进行:
- qPCR验证:通过定量PCR实验验证差异表达基因的表达量。
- Western Blot验证:通过蛋白质印迹实验验证差异表达基因的蛋白水平。
- 其他数据集验证:使用其他独立数据集验证分析结果的普适性。
验证后,可以进行进一步的功能研究,如基因敲除/过表达实验、蛋白互作研究等,以深入理解差异表达基因在生物过程中的具体作用。
八、工具和平台选择
在进行GEO测序数据分析时,选择合适的工具和平台可以提高分析效率和结果的可靠性。除了上述提到的DESeq2、edgeR和limma,还可以使用一些集成分析平台,如:
- FineBI:帆软旗下的商业智能工具,提供强大的数据处理和可视化功能,适用于大规模基因组数据的分析和展示。FineBI官网: https://s.fanruan.com/f459r;
- Galaxy:一个开放的网络平台,提供一系列生物信息学工具,用户可以通过图形界面进行数据分析。
- Bioconductor:一个开放源码的软件项目,提供了大量用于基因组数据分析的R包。
九、数据存储和共享
在完成数据分析后,存储和共享数据是非常重要的,可以促进研究的透明性和可重复性。可以将分析结果上传到公共数据库,如GEO、ArrayExpress等,或使用实验室内部的数据库进行存储。同时,可以通过发表论文、制作报告等方式分享研究成果。
十、最新进展和未来方向
随着测序技术和数据分析方法的不断进步,GEO测序数据分析也在不断发展。未来的研究方向包括:
- 单细胞测序数据分析:随着单细胞测序技术的发展,分析单细胞水平的基因表达差异将成为一个重要方向。
- 多组学数据整合分析:将基因组、转录组、蛋白质组、代谢组等多组学数据进行整合分析,可以更全面地理解生物系统的复杂性。
- 机器学习和人工智能在生物信息学中的应用:利用机器学习和人工智能技术,可以从海量数据中挖掘出更多有价值的信息,提高分析的准确性和效率。
通过不断学习和应用最新的分析技术和工具,可以更深入地理解基因表达调控机制,推动生物医学研究的发展。
相关问答FAQs:
什么是geo测序数据,如何获取?
GEO(Gene Expression Omnibus)测序数据是指在GEO数据库中存储的基因表达数据和相关实验信息。GEO数据库由美国国家生物技术信息中心(NCBI)维护,提供了大量的基因组、转录组和表观基因组测序数据。用户可以通过GEO的官方网站搜索特定的实验数据,下载相应的测序数据集。获取数据时,用户通常需要关注数据的类型(如RNA-Seq、ChIP-Seq等)、实验设计、样本信息和数据处理方法等。这些信息有助于后续的分析和结果解释。
对于初学者来说,建议先熟悉GEO数据库的基本结构和查询功能。可以通过关键词、作者、实验类型等多种方式进行搜索,找到感兴趣的数据集。下载的数据通常包括原始测序数据(如.fastq文件)和处理后数据(如.RPKM、FPKM值等)。在下载前,了解实验的具体背景和设计原则非常重要,这将有助于在数据分析阶段更好地解读结果。
geo测序数据分析的步骤有哪些?
分析GEO测序数据通常包括数据预处理、质量控制、差异表达分析、功能注释和结果可视化等步骤。以下是每个步骤的详细说明:
-
数据预处理:下载后,首先需要对原始测序数据进行预处理。这包括质量控制(使用工具如FastQC)、去除低质量序列和接头序列。可以使用Trimmomatic等工具来进行序列修剪,以确保后续分析的准确性。
-
数据对齐:将清洗后的序列比对到参考基因组或转录组上。常用的比对工具包括Bowtie、STAR和HISAT2。对齐结果通常以BAM格式存储,后续分析将基于此结果。
-
计数矩阵生成:通过对齐结果生成基因表达计数矩阵,通常使用HTSeq或featureCounts等工具。这一步骤将得到每个样本中每个基因的表达量数据。
-
差异表达分析:使用DESeq2或edgeR等R包进行差异表达分析。该步骤旨在识别在不同条件下显著变化的基因,并计算相应的P值和Fold Change。
-
功能注释:对差异表达的基因进行功能注释,常用的工具包括DAVID、KEGG和GO富集分析。这将帮助研究者理解基因在生物学过程中的作用及其潜在的生物学意义。
-
结果可视化:使用R语言的ggplot2、pheatmap等包进行数据可视化。可以生成火山图、热图和箱线图等,直观地展示差异表达基因的分布和特征。
在分析过程中,保持对数据的严谨态度非常重要,确保每一步的结果都经过充分验证,以提高最终结论的可信度。
如何处理geo测序数据中的常见问题?
处理GEO测序数据时,研究者可能会遇到一些常见问题,如数据缺失、技术噪声、批次效应等。以下是一些应对这些问题的策略:
-
数据缺失:在分析前,应检查数据集中的缺失值。可以使用插补法(如KNN插补)或删除缺失值严重的样本,以减少对后续分析的影响。确保在报告结果时说明缺失值的处理方法。
-
技术噪声:测序数据本身可能受到技术噪声的影响。可以通过重复实验或使用技术生物学重复来降低噪声的影响。此外,在差异表达分析中,选择合适的统计模型也能有效降低噪声的干扰。
-
批次效应:在大规模数据集中,批次效应可能导致样本间的系统性差异。可以使用ComBat或SVA等工具进行批次效应校正,以提高数据的可比性。这一步骤在分析前非常关键,尤其是在多中心研究中。
-
结果解释:对分析结果的生物学解释需要谨慎,避免过度推断。需要结合已有文献和实验结果,确保结论的合理性和可重复性。
-
数据共享与重用:在完成分析后,可以考虑将结果和数据共享至公共数据库,促进科学研究的开放性和透明度。确保遵循相关的伦理和法律规定。
通过合理的策略和工具,研究者可以有效地处理GEO测序数据中的各种问题,提高分析的准确性和可靠性。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



